Recreation vessel (1690)
Scale: 1:32. A contemporary full hull model of an English yacht (1690), built plank on frame in the Navy Board style. The lavishly decorated hull is complete with 16 wreathed gun ports, of which ten are dummies, a deeply carved taffrail above the stern, a quarter `badge' on either side to provide light into the state cabin, and a double-headed figurehead reflecting the dual monarchy of William and Mary.
This vessel was cutter rigged with a single mast and was steered by a tiller, located on the poop deck aft.
